All (20146)
Notes (10000)
note
The Ancient Mediterranean
Updated 250d ago
0.0(0)
note
Ancient Mediterranean
Updated 545d ago
0.0(0)
note
Ancient Mediterranean Summary
Updated 401d ago
0.0(0)
Users (146)